Abstract

fetched live from OpenAlex

Recently,with the acceleration of the process of urbanization in China.Environmental problems are becoming more and more apparent.Such as heat island effect,air pollution,sewage overflow,noise pollution those seem to be a common problem in the process of urban development.However,the emergence of the green roof can play a positive role on solving these urban environmental problems and which accepted by designers,developers and environmental experts.Green roof is not a new concept of environmental protection.In the 60s of last century,this word was appeared in United States,Britain,Germany,Canada and other countries.By now Switzerland,Austria,Germany,Japan and other advanced countries all make green roofs mandatory by legislation.So this paper will analyse and summarize the characteristics and category of green roof to elaborate the value of different types of green roofs that contribute to urban landscape.
